I am using Captivate 9 and posting results to an internal server.

However the results only appear once for the same lesson if I send from a computer with a cable internet connection.

This is the situation:

Multiple submissions (from different learners) for the same lesson (desired outcome):

  • When using a wireless connection (desktop or device)
  • When published locally (not on the web server)
  • When previewed locally in a browser (not on a web server)

Submission of data for the same lesson only arrives the first time:

  • When data is submitted from the web server version of the tutorial from computers with cable network connections

My IT department say it must be a Captivate problem but given that the data sends when previewed locally or when using wireless I think there is something else going on.

Thanks for responding - actually we have been checking thoroughly after each submission so we know they're not being overwritten.

We did discover is that it's related to the security status of the internal server. The server where the tutorial is sitting is https and the internal server that the Captivate results are sent to is http. This meant that some browsers were treating the submissions differently - sending it through on some browsers but not others.
